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26743517 558044359 3529889725 96601263147 0395520
721 1390
721 1390
83562330 307934 16317
All about undefined
Interested in learning more?
721 1390
83562330 307934 16317
See more
0449 66357941 1075924641
357426 43591598198 553340 76 59790245
See more
95472495 02997867 1235388
824974 2254182 658889901
See more